  • this is the mobile medical alert system made by Bell and distributed by medscope America the button comes to you in a box with a clear pamphlet filled with instructions on how to activate and operate your button the button is able to perform many different tasks to keep you safe it offers fall detection GPS tracking clear two-way communication with the Dispatch Center the med scope of America Monitoring Center is staffed by professionals that conduct 24/7 monitoring to keep the clients safe if you ever need help all you have to do is simply push your button say agent and the button connects itself to the call center in an agent will answer your call this agent is professionally trained and knows what is necessary to get you the help you need in a very timely manner if you have any questions or would like to find out other services that the med school corporation can offer you can call medscope at 1-800-645-2060 Monday through Friday from 9: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. eastern time 8:00 a.m. to 4:00 p.m. Central Time you also can contact your local social worker to offer you assistance to navigate your experience you should also know that this device every 7 to 10 days and it can receive Services anywhere in the lower 48 states thank you for watching the video and have a good day

    Very nice Chris. Does this device need landline, internet or satellite? My Grandma had one 4 yrs ago that was dependant on her landline. Her landline would often go out so her Life Alert wouldn't work either.
    Thank You for sharing.

    • @cruiserchrisworldnetwork4141
      @cruiserchrisworldnetwork4141  11 месяцев назад +2

      To answer your question red rose for that particular system that I demonstrated in the video you do not need a landline or an internet connection that system works off of cell phone towers and it also has GPS in the system so follow that number that I give you in the video and you should be able to find out more information good luck with your grandma's search for this and yes I am starting to feel better
